中国人形机器人龙头企业宇树科技于8月10日启动首次公开发行申购。[2] 本次发行价格为150.80元/股,对应上市市值约609.93亿元,[2][3] 预计中签率仅为万分之二至万分之三,[1][2] 远低于此前上市的中国DRAM大厂长鑫科技的0.47%。[1] 中一签(500股)需缴款7.54万元,缴款截止日为8月12日。[2]
本次发行募资约61亿元,[2] 主要投向智能机器人模型研发、机器人本体研发、新型产品开发及制造基地建设。[2] 根据2026年来A股新股平均涨幅276.04%测算,若中一签账面按此幅度增长,盈利有望突破20万元。[2] 宇树科技2023年至2025年营业收入分别为1.59亿元、3.93亿元、16.99亿元,[2][3] 对应净利润分别为-1,114.51万元、9,547.47万元、2.78亿元。[2][3] 2026年第一季度营业收入约4.23亿元,同比增长68.49%。[3]
值得注意的是,无人机企业大疆曾在2018年以1,012.86万元获得宇树科技约17%的股份,成为其最大外部股东,当时对应宇树科技估值约6,000万元。[3] 但大疆在2019年选择减资退出,[3] 因此错失了宇树科技后续数十亿元的市值增长。[3]
Unitree Robotics, a leading manufacturer of humanoid robots in China, has initiated its initial public offering (IPO) subscription on August 10, 2024.[2] The subscription odds are exceptionally competitive, with a winning rate of only 0.02% to 0.03%, significantly lower than Changxin Technology, a major Chinese DRAM manufacturer that went public earlier with a winning rate of 0.47%.[1]
The IPO is priced at 150.80 yuan per share, with a total fundraising target of approximately 6.1 billion yuan.[2] A single lot comprising 500 shares requires an investment of 75,400 yuan.[2] The offering values the company at approximately 60.993 billion yuan at the time of listing, corresponding to a post-issuance price-to-earnings ratio of 219 times based on 2025 financial results.[2][3] Investors must complete payment by August 12.[2]
Unitree Robotics has demonstrated strong recent growth in its financial performance.[3] The company's revenues surged from 159 million yuan in 2023 to 393 million yuan in 2024, and further accelerated to 1.699 billion yuan in 2025.[2][3] Net profit moved from a loss of 111.451 million yuan in 2023 to 95.4747 million yuan in 2024 and 278 million yuan in 2025.[2][3] For the first quarter of 2026, revenue reached approximately 423 million yuan, representing year-over-year growth of 68.49%, with first-half 2026 revenue projected between 1.052 billion and 1.128 billion yuan.[3]
The IPO proceeds will be directed toward research and development of intelligent robot models (2.022 billion yuan), robot platform development, new product innovation, and manufacturing facility construction.[2]
